In today's fast-paced world, technology is constantly evolving and shaping every aspect of our lives, including the way we cook and experience food. From smart ovens to molecular gastronomy techniques, modern cooking technology is advancing at a rapid pace, offering exciting possibilities for the future of cuisine. One of the most significant trends in modern cooking technology is the integration of artificial intelligence and machine learning. Smart appliances like ovens, refrigerators, and cooktops are now equipped with sensors and cameras that can monitor food as it cooks, adjust temperature settings, and even suggest recipes based on the ingredients available. This level of automation not only makes cooking more efficient but also allows for greater precision and consistency in the final dishes. Cutting-edge cooking technologies such as sous-vide machines and induction cooktops have also gained popularity in recent years. Sous-vide, a cooking technique that involves vacuum-sealing food and cooking it in a precisely controlled water bath, allows for perfectly cooked proteins with unparalleled tenderness and flavor. Similarly, induction cooktops use electromagnetic technology to heat pots and pans directly, offering faster cooking times and greater energy efficiency compared to traditional gas or electric stoves. In the realm of molecular gastronomy, chefs and food scientists are pushing the boundaries of culinary creativity by using techniques such as spherification, foams, and gels to transform familiar ingredients into innovative dishes that engage all the senses. By combining science and artistry, molecular gastronomy aims to evoke emotions and memories through food, creating immersive dining experiences that delight and surprise the palate.
